Advertisement
Guest User

Untitled

a guest
Mar 30th, 2017
100
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.77 KB | None | 0 0
  1. function addMarker(place)
  2. {
  3. // TODO
  4. var myLat = new google.maps.LatLng(place.latitude, place.longitude);
  5.  
  6. var articles = $.getJSON(Flask.url_for("articles"), place.postal_code);
  7. var content = "<ul>";
  8. for (i = 0; i < 5; i++) {
  9. var link = "<a href=" + articles[i].link + articles[i].title + "</a>";
  10. content = content + link;
  11. }
  12. content = content + "</ul>";
  13.  
  14. var marker = new google.maps.Marker({
  15. position: myLat,
  16. map: map,
  17. });
  18. marker.setMap(map);
  19.  
  20. var infoMarker = new google.maps.InfoWindow({
  21. content: content
  22. });
  23.  
  24. google.maps.event.addListener(marker, "click", function() {
  25. infoMarker.open(map, marker);
  26. });
  27.  
  28. markers.push(marker);
  29.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ement